Transaction 771aaf25c59577171603e5af6acfda09d5bf1c9cf74e144955cb7d226550d980
1 Input
1 Output
-
771aaf25c59577171603e5af6acfda09d5bf1c9cf74e144955cb7d226550d980:0
- value
- 1456748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c3f40dddf21ea8a0d6e1776b21b7fcc80c72bf3 OP_EQUAL
- address
- 3JrNjXhfHEjtUtGFaoJ4j33ztCbFU9Jsex